[Сценарий] Погода от Яндекс

Не требует установки программ или изменения файлов

Модераторы: immortal, newz20

utia38
Сообщения: 82
Зарегистрирован: Ср авг 26, 2015 9:22 pm
Откуда: г.Обнинск, Калужская обл.
Благодарил (а): 1 раз
Поблагодарили: 9 раз
Контактная информация:

Re: Погода (Яндекс)

Сообщение utia38 » Чт дек 03, 2015 1:56 pm

поставить скрипт в onNewHour
Вложения
погода6.jpg
погода6.jpg (79.55 КБ) 14327 просмотров
погода7.jpg
погода7.jpg (139.21 КБ) 14327 просмотров
погода8.jpg
погода8.jpg (59.15 КБ) 14327 просмотров
Мазур
Сообщения: 133
Зарегистрирован: Чт ноя 26, 2015 3:52 pm
Благодарил (а): 32 раза
Поблагодарили: 1 раз

Re: Погода (Яндекс)

Сообщение Мазур » Чт дек 03, 2015 2:32 pm

Не получается. (((
1.jpg
1.jpg (49.35 КБ) 14322 просмотра
А при запуске в ручную выдает это.

Warning: file_get_contents(http://127.0.0.1:8090/-outputchannel:1 %D0%A1%D0%B5%D0%B3%D0%BE%D0%B4%D0%BD%D1%8F+0.):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

Warning: file_get_contents(http://127.0.0.1:8090/-outputchannel:1 +%D0%A2%D0%B5%D0%BC%D0%BF%D0%B5%D1%80%D0%B0%D1%82%D1%83%D1%80%D0%B0+0+%D0%B3%D1%80%D0%B0%D0%B4%D1%83%D1%81%D0%BE%D0%B2+%D1%86%D0%B5%D0%BB%D1%8C%D1%81%D0%B8%D1%8F):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

Warning: file_get_contents(http://127.0.0.1:8090/-outputchannel:1 %D0%9E%D1%82%D0%BD%D0%BE%D1%81%D0%B8%D1%82%D0%B5%D0%BB%D1%8C%D0%BD%D0%B0%D1%8F+%D0%B2%D0%BB%D0%B0%D0%B6%D0%BD%D0%BE%D1%81%D1%82%D1%8C+0+%D0%BF%D1%80%D0%BE%D1%86%D0%B5%D0%BD%D1%82%D0%BE%D0%B2.):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

Warning: file_get_contents(http://127.0.0.1:8090/-outputchannel:1 +%D0%90%D1%82%D0%BC%D0%BE%D1%81%D1%84%D0%B5%D1%80%D0%BD%D0%BE%D0%B5+%D0%B4%D0%B0%D0%B2%D0%BB%D0%B5%D0%BD%D0%B8%D0%B5+%D0%BF%D0%BE%D0%BD%D0%B8%D0%B6%D0%B5%D0%BD%D0%BD%D0%BE%D0%B5):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

Warning: file_get_contents(http://127.0.0.1:8090/-outputchannel:1 +%D0%92%D0%B5%D1%82%D1%80%D0%B0+%D0%BD%D0%B5%D1%82.+%D0%9D%D0%B0%D0%BF%D1%80%D0%B0%D0%B2%D0%BB%D0%B5%D0%BD%D0%B8%D0%B5+0.):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43
utia38
Сообщения: 82
Зарегистрирован: Ср авг 26, 2015 9:22 pm
Откуда: г.Обнинск, Калужская обл.
Благодарил (а): 1 раз
Поблагодарили: 9 раз
Контактная информация:

Re: Погода (Яндекс)

Сообщение utia38 » Чт дек 03, 2015 9:21 pm

так точка должна на поле КОД стоять . а в коде написано runscript....
Вложения
погода8.jpg
погода8.jpg (59.15 КБ) 14290 просмотров
Аватара пользователя
Amarok
Сообщения: 1425
Зарегистрирован: Пт дек 14, 2012 12:24 pm
Откуда: Россия, Нижняя Тура
Благодарил (а): 460 раз
Поблагодарили: 126 раз
Контактная информация:

Re: Погода (Яндекс)

Сообщение Amarok » Пт дек 04, 2015 8:45 am

У меня в onNewMinute это:

Код: Выделить всё

 if ($m%30 == 0) {runScript("WeatherFromYandex");}//обновляем погоду с Яндекса каждые 30 минут 
Алиска живёт на Ubuntu Server 14.04.3 LTS
connect, группа в Telegram, Яндекс.Деньги для благодарностей за помощь: 41001355945165
Мазур
Сообщения: 133
Зарегистрирован: Чт ноя 26, 2015 3:52 pm
Благодарил (а): 32 раза
Поблагодарили: 1 раз

Re: Погода (Яндекс)

Сообщение Мазур » Пт дек 04, 2015 9:06 am

Так я так и делаю. :(
1.jpg
1.jpg (66.26 КБ) 14278 просмотров
Нажимаю обновить

После появляется это
2.jpg
2.jpg (98.8 КБ) 14278 просмотров
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: Погода (Яндекс)

Сообщение skysilver » Пт дек 04, 2015 9:36 am

Точку с запятой ( ; ) в конце каждой строки надо поставить.
За это сообщение автора skysilver поблагодарил:
Мазур (Пт дек 04, 2015 10:22 am)
Рейтинг: 1.16%
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Мазур
Сообщения: 133
Зарегистрирован: Чт ноя 26, 2015 3:52 pm
Благодарил (а): 32 раза
Поблагодарили: 1 раз

Re: Погода (Яндекс)

Сообщение Мазур » Пт дек 04, 2015 10:37 am

А что за ошибка может быть при запуске onNewMinute

Warning: file_get_contents(http://127.0.0.1:8090/%D0%A7%D0%B8%D1%8 ... %81+Yandex):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

Warning: file_get_contents(http://127.0.0.1:8090/%D0%A7%D0%B8%D1%8 ... %81+Yandex): in E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43

И подобная ошибка выскакивает при команде в командной строке...
E:\majordomo\htdocs\modules\scripts\scripts.class.php(139) : eval()'d code on line 43
utia38
Сообщения: 82
Зарегистрирован: Ср авг 26, 2015 9:22 pm
Откуда: г.Обнинск, Калужская обл.
Благодарил (а): 1 раз
Поблагодарили: 9 раз
Контактная информация:

Re: Погода (Яндекс)

Сообщение utia38 » Пт дек 04, 2015 3:24 pm

насчет ошибки не знаю, что может быть. Ну а в итоге ПОГОДА заработала?
Мазур
Сообщения: 133
Зарегистрирован: Чт ноя 26, 2015 3:52 pm
Благодарил (а): 32 раза
Поблагодарили: 1 раз

Re: Погода (Яндекс)

Сообщение Мазур » Сб дек 05, 2015 10:10 am

погода работает только при ручном пуске onNewHour
utia38
Сообщения: 82
Зарегистрирован: Ср авг 26, 2015 9:22 pm
Откуда: г.Обнинск, Калужская обл.
Благодарил (а): 1 раз
Поблагодарили: 9 раз
Контактная информация:

Re: Погода (Яндекс)

Сообщение utia38 » Сб дек 05, 2015 6:05 pm

печально как-то :cry: :cry: :cry:
Ответить